The EU-funded DECODE project (DE-centralised ClOud Labs for inDustrialisation of Energy Materials) aims to break these barriers with a decentralized, adaptive cloud-connected labs concept. It digitally connects labs advancing methods in materials characterization, modelling, simulation, fabrication, and testing, focused on sustainable hydrogen technologies. DECODE’s modular platform connects universities and institutions to accelerate clean energy R&D. From December 2023, DECODE has worked to bridge gaps between lab-scale tests and real-world conditions, addressing data fragmentation, missing metadata, and ecosystem silos. Integrated workflows are being developed to accelerate R&D timelines and support climate goals. Platform elements include DECODE FABRIC (collaboration matrix), IRL (tool integration scores), FOUNDRY (a knowledge graph using reinforcement learning), and an AI-enabled CPU to orchestrate workflows. In its first phase, DECODE assembled tools to study the local reaction environment (LRE), identified knowledge gaps, and defined Fact Sheets and Property Correlation Trees. Initial multiparametric activity-durability descriptors were generated to guide materials design and integration. Ongoing efforts build correlative workflows linking modelling and testing to device metrics. The DECODE CPU will adaptively coordinate modular R&D tasks in real time. Together, the platform’s tools, knowledge structures, and AI orchestration will accelerate clean energy innovation through coordinated, cloud-connected research.
